Midas need so much room not just because they grow to 10-12" within a year, but also because they are very active fish. They enjoy and need at least 4 feet of swimming length, and more if you can provide it. Unfortunately, large cichlids are often bought as small juveniles and the owner has no idea what they're getting into.
